Forgiveness: a philosophical study
The author's analysis of forgiveness is important not only in its own right, but it also opens up areas of further philosophical reflection, for instance, on how forgiveness operates in non paradigmatic situations, for example, when injury is carelessly but not intentionally inflicted. Haber's book will provide the starting-points for this and other inquiries into a significant feature of our common moral discourse.
